Florida Expansion Ahead of Schedule
The Florida expansion project is progressing even better than expected.
The opening for the expansion is still set for Fall of this year. The fast pace means that more time will be allowed for extra dinosaurs to move into the new area.
The park will remain open during the entire expansion process. Please notice signage when you arrive in regards to parking. In addition to a new parking area, there will be 12 new acres to enjoy. A 22,000 square foot building will house a new indoor Prehistoric Museum, gift shop and office space. A new dinosaur playground will be unveiled as well as more picnic areas. And of course new dinosaurs will be moving in to show off the new entrance and gateway to the dinosaur walk. Below is a photo of progress on the new entryway.
